Output 295a37b3441db95573b13f71be840cee733d340916e22153b30cc99f8e877287:19

value
2582157
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23ba2a39a1c92ea346472a433f0bd00a34da9af8 OP_EQUALVERIFY OP_CHECKSIG
address
14FufgVrr8X9LCWA4nERLxoCU8PsEng5jb
transaction
295a37b3441db95573b13f71be840cee733d340916e22153b30cc99f8e877287
spent
true